Apache软件基金会:卓越创新引领开源技术前沿浪潮

adminc 电脑游戏 2025-03-25 23 0

当开源技术成为数字社会的基石,谁来守护创新的火种?

Apache软件基金会:卓越创新引领开源技术前沿浪潮

在ChatGPT掀起人工智能浪潮、区块链重构信任体系的今天,全球97%的互联网服务器运行着开源软件。面对层出不穷的网络安全事件和商业利益裹挟,Apache软件基金会用22年时间培育出350+顶级项目,形成独特的技术创新生态。这个没有风险投资、不追求商业回报的组织,如何在保持开放协作的持续引领技术前沿?

1. 开放协作如何成就技术安全?

Apache软件基金会:卓越创新引领开源技术前沿浪潮

2025年3月爆发的Tomcat RCE漏洞(CVE-2025-24813)事件,成为检验Apache协作安全机制的试金石。该漏洞影响范围覆盖9.0至11.0的多个版本,攻击者可利用文件会话持久化功能实现远程代码执行。但漏洞披露仅48小时后,Apache社区就发布补丁更新。这种快速响应源于其特有的「群体智慧」机制——每个项目PMC(项目管理委员会)由8-15位全球顶尖开发者组成,他们既负责代码审核,也建立漏洞应急响应流程。 更值得关注的是漏洞披露过程中的「透明法则」。从安全研究员提交漏洞报告,到开发者邮件列表讨论修复方案,整个过程在加密邮件组公开进行。这种看似冒险的机制,实则通过全球技术专家的共同监督,确保修复方案经受住最严苛的检验。正如Apache Tomcat项目主席Mark Thomas所言:"我们的安全不是靠保密,而是靠千万双眼睛的审视。

2. 技术演进怎样突破创新瓶颈?

在数据湖技术激烈竞争的2025年,Apache Iceberg的崛起堪称教科书级案例。这个起源于Netflix的开源项目,通过引入「行级谱系追踪」和「二进制删除向量」等创新,将数据更新效率提升300%,成功吸引Snowflake、Databricks等行业巨头共建生态。其成功密码藏在Apache的「孵化器机制」中:每个新项目必须经过至少3位导师指导、社区投票、代码捐赠审查等7个阶段,确保技术方向与社区需求深度契合。 另一个典范是Apache Answer的进化之路。这个中文团队主导的问答平台,在成为顶级项目的2年内,构建起包含78位代码贡献者、162位志愿者的全球化社区,支持15种语言界面,形成插件市场、声望系统等完整生态。这验证了Apache著名的「精英治理」原则:技术决策权仅授予实际贡献者,无关企业背景或资历深浅,真正实现「代码面前人人平等」。

3. 社区生态如何孕育持久生命力?

观察Apache Doris的发展轨迹可见端倪:这个中国团队主导的实时分析数据库,在2022年成为顶级项目后,贡献者数量以每月20人的速度增长,形成查询优化器、数据湖等5个专项小组。其生态扩张的秘密在于「功勋制度」——开发者通过代码贡献、文档翻译、漏洞修复等具体行动积累「功勋值」,获得从提交者到PMC成员的身份晋升。这种量化评价体系,让华为工程师陈亮等技术专家从企业代表转型为社区领袖。 2025年北京CommunityOverCode亚洲大会的筹备,则展现着生态运营的艺术。大会设置「新手训练营」「黑客马拉松」等环节,要求每个技术议题必须配备实践工作坊。这种「参与式会议」设计,使得上届会议中23%的参会者最终转化为项目贡献者。正如新任董事陈梓立所说:"我们要做的不是技术布道,而是点燃每个人心中的创造之火。

站在开源巨人的肩膀上

对于企业技术决策者,建议优先选用经过Apache成熟度模型认证的项目,参与「导师计划」培养内部开源专家;开发者可以从文档翻译、测试用例编写等「低门槛贡献」起步,逐步深入核心模块开发;普通用户则应善用邮件列表和JIRA系统,用真实场景反馈推动技术演进。 当Apache软件基金会的项目支撑着纽约证券交易所的实时交易、维系着阿里云百万级容器集群运行时,这个由志愿者构建的技术乌托邦,正在用「精英协作+民主治理」的创新模式证明:开放源代码不仅能创造商业价值,更能孕育出超越商业的永恒创新力。正如Apache信条所昭示的——"社区重于代码",这或许正是数字文明时代技术演进的全新范式。